Ribosomes are made up of rRNA and protein. As its name suggests, rRNA is A serious constituent of ribosomes, composing around about 60% with the ribosome by mass and supplying The placement wherever the mRNA binds. The rRNA ensures the right alignment of the mRNA, tRNA, along with the ribosomes; the rRNA from the ribosome also has an enzymatic exercise (peptidyl transferase) and catalyzes the development from the peptide bonds concerning two aligned amino acids in the course of protein synthesis.

The disposition of the drug in the human body consists of absorption, distribution, metabolism, and excretion (ADME). ADME is a vital element within the drug design system, which scientific tests the fate of the drug molecule immediately after administration. It truly is a complex system involving transporters and metabolizing enzymes with physiological outcomes on pharmacological and toxicological outcomes, and can Enjoy A significant function in drug structure for figuring out better drug molecules in a far more successful way. Metabolism of drugs in the body is a posh biotransformation method where drugs are structurally modified to unique molecules (metabolites) by different metabolizing enzymes. Studies on drug metabolism are essential processes to optimize guide compounds for optimum PK/PD Houses, to determine new chemical entities based upon the obtaining of active metabolites, to reduce potential security liabilities as a result of development of reactive or toxic metabolites, and to match preclinical metabolism in animals with people for guaranteeing opportunity ample protection of human metabolites in animals and for supporting human dose prediction, and so forth.

Carbon monoxide binds to and inhibits cytochrome c oxidase (advanced IV). Besides the disruption with the And many others, carbon monoxide also binds to hemoglobin at an oxygen-binding internet site converting it to carboxyhemoglobin. In this particular condition, oxygen is displaced from hemoglobin, efficiently blocking shipping and delivery to physique tissues. The cardiac and central anxious systems, both of those organ systems which can be very dependent on oxygen consumption, manifest the popular indications of CO poisoning.
